Usually, you have enough lead time before moving to a new house to decide what to take with you and what to give away. Why not go green and apply that same forethought to packing supplies? Save used boxes, bubble wrap, corrugated cardboard, and tissue from packages and gifts you receive to help with your relocation.

It doesn’t matter if your movers can carry a tune, what really matters is if they can carry a piano.

 

Pianos are delicate and finely tuned musical instruments. They’re valuable, not just price-wise, but for the joy they can bring. Of course, they are heavy too. That combination, one of robustness and delicacy, calls for a professional touch when moving them. A piano that gets bashed and battered, and maybe even dropped, is going to be nicked and scratched at the very least. Rough handling will likely knock it out of tune as well.
